Alma Mater By a mighty river deepened With each rising tide, P.H.S. our Alma Mater Stands a lasting guide. Chorus: Steadfast, loyal sons and daughters Ready at thy call, Mind and heart we pledge that never Shall our banner fall. Ever mindful of thy teachings Side by side we stand, To preserve the sound traditions Of our school and land. All of our different creeds and races, We laid at thy shrine.
